This study plans to initiate a prospective, randomized controlled trial to investigate the optimal timing of antibody drug conjugate (ADC) therapy in the management of advanced Human Epidermal Growth Factor Receptor 2 (HER2)-negative breast cancer.
Primary Objective:
To compare the difference in PFS2 (Time from randomization to disease progression after second therapy) between antibody-drug conjugate (ADC) followed by chemotherapy versus chemotherapy followed by ADC in the treatment of advanced HER2-negative breast cancer.
Secondary Objectives:
To compare overall survival (OS), adverse events, patient-reported outcomes, and cost-effectiveness between the two treatment sequences. Additionally, to identify potential biomarkers predictive of benefit from frontline ADC therapy.

The selection of ADC agents will be based on the patient's molecular subtype. For Hormone receptor (HR)+/HER2-low patients, anti-HER2 ADCs such as trastuzumab deruxtecan may be used. For HR+/HER2-zero patients, TROP-2-targeted ADCs such as sacituzumab govitecan are preferred. For HR-/HER2-low patients, either anti-HER2 ADCs or Trophoblast cell surface antigen 2 (TROP-2) ADCs may be considered. For HR-/HER2-zero patients, TROP-2 ADCs will be used. The specific ADC regimen will be determined at the discretion of the investigators.
The chemotherapy regimen will consist of standard second-line agents such as capecitabine, eribulin, vinorelbine, or gemcitabine. The specific chemotherapy regimen will be determined at the discretion of the investigators.
